Excubitor Game Project

Excubitor Game Project

Recent Posts

Back to top

February 2021

  /    /  February

Introduction to League of Legends (LOL) League of Legends, or just LOL is one of the most popular esports games in the world, and there are thousands of people who watch the championships on the Twitch site and take part in League of Legends betting, knowing all the odds and following every move of the most famous teams like 9Cloud and